Salary overview

The median wage for Heavy and Tractor-Trailer Truck Drivers in Charleston, SC is $55,150 per year, close to the national median of $58,640 for the same occupation. Half of workers earn between $48,300 and $66,260. Beyond that band, the tenth percentile sits at $41,590 and the ninetieth at $77,550.

Employment stands at 6,020, or 15.3 jobs per thousand held locally. Within the state, Florence records the highest median at $55,550. Of the 513 occupations with published wages in this area, it sits 284th.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Charleston run 6.3% below the national average, so the median of $55,150 goes as far as $58,858 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way it compares to the national median at 0.4% above the national median in real terms.
